In Surah Ibrahim (14:24-25), Allah, Al-Musawwir (The Shaper of Forms and Beauty), illustrates by way of a parable about kalimatan tayyibatan (a good word) comparing it to a good tree. A good tree has several outcomes: growing, bearing abundant fruit, casting shadows, sustaining itself and bearing fruit under all kinds of circumstances. A monotheistic person too is always growing, revealing signs of faith in speech and actions, continuously through the seasons of life, always calling others to Islam and persuading them to do what is right and stay away from what is wrong. Allah, in the Holy Qur’an, refers to other things that are tayyibah (good), such as tawhid (monotheism), iman (faith), correct and sound ideas, the Prophets and their companions and followers. Tawhid is inherently rooted and fixed in our fitrah (human nature), just as a tree is fixed by its roots in the ground. The tree of tawhid is fixed and its branches extend to Paradise. It is impossible to uproot or eradicate it. Only by the permission of the Lord can a tree survive and bear fruit and only by the permission of our Lord can we stay faithful and speak kalimatan tayyibatan and call others to the Way of Allah.
